Understanding Root Canal Treatment
A root canal is a dental procedure designed to treat infection at the centre of a tooth. During this treatment, the infected pulp is removed, and the inside of the tooth is cleaned and sealed. The Risks of Delaying a Root Canal
- Increased Pain and Discomfort One of the most immediate consequences of delaying a root canal is the escalation of pain. As the infection progresses, the discomfort can become unbearable. Patients may find themselves relying on over-the-counter pain relievers that only provide temporary relief. - Spread of Infection An untreated infection can spread beyond the tooth, affecting surrounding tissues and even leading to systemic issues. This can result in abscess formation, which may require more invasive treatments. - Loss of Tooth Delaying a root canal can ultimately lead to tooth loss. If the infection is not treated in a timely manner, the tooth may become too damaged to save. - Increased Treatment Complexity The longer a patient waits to undergo a root canal, the more complicated the treatment may become. In some cases, additional procedures such as surgery may be required to address the damage caused by the prolonged infection. Signs You Need a Root Canal
Patients should be aware of the signs that indicate the need for a root canal. These can include:
- Severe toothache that may radiate to the jaw or neck
- Prolonged sensitivity to hot or cold temperatures
- Discolouration of the tooth
- Swelling and tenderness in the surrounding gums
